3. Product Overview

The Senco KC27APBK framing nails are designed for heavy-duty construction applications. These 3-inch nails feature a plain finish, clipped head, smooth shank, and diamond point, collated at a 34-degree angle for compatibility with specific framing nailers.

4. Specifications

FeatureDetail
Model NumberKC27APBK
Overall Length3 inches
Shank Diameter0.131 inches
MaterialSteel
FinishPlain
Head TypeClipped
Shank TypeSmooth
Point TypeDiamond
Collation TypeTape
Collation Angle34 Degrees
Package Quantity2500 nails
Compatible NailersSenco F-35XP, FN91T1, FP325XP, FP701XP, FP751XP

5. Setup and Loading

  1. Ensure Safety: Disconnect your framing nailer from its air supply or power source before loading nails.
  2. Open Magazine: Open the nailer's magazine according to its specific instructions.
  3. Insert Nails: Insert a strip of Senco KC27APBK nails into the magazine, ensuring the collation angle matches the nailer's design (34 degrees). The nail points should face forward.
  4. Close Magazine: Close the magazine securely until it latches.
  5. Reconnect Power: Reconnect the nailer to its air supply or power source.

Note: Always refer to your specific nailer's instruction manual for detailed loading procedures.

6. Operating Instructions

These nails are designed for use with compatible Senco framing nailers (e.g., F-35XP, FN91T1, FP325XP, FP701XP, FP751XP). Ensure the nailer is set to the appropriate depth for the material being fastened.

  • Material Compatibility: Suitable for framing, sheathing, subflooring, and other heavy-duty wood construction.
  • Nailer Settings: Adjust the nailer's depth setting to achieve flush fastening without over-driving or under-driving the nails. Test on a scrap piece of material first.
  • Firing: Follow your nailer's operating instructions for single-shot or bump-fire modes. Maintain a firm grip and stable stance.

7. Storage and Handling

Store Senco KC27APBK nails in a dry environment to prevent rust and corrosion, which can affect performance and potentially damage your nailer. Keep nails in their original packaging until ready for use. Avoid dropping or bending nail strips, as this can lead to misfires or jams.

8. Troubleshooting (Nail-Related)

  • Nail Jams: If nails jam, disconnect the nailer from its power source immediately. Carefully follow your nailer's instructions for clearing jams. Ensure nails are not bent or damaged before loading.
  • Misfires/Inconsistent Firing: Check if the nails are properly loaded and not damaged. Ensure the nailer is compatible with 34-degree collated nails. Verify the air pressure (for pneumatic nailers) is within the recommended range for your tool.
  • Nails Not Driving Fully: Adjust the nailer's depth setting. Ensure adequate air pressure (for pneumatic nailers). Check for worn driver blades or other nailer issues (refer to your nailer's manual).

For comprehensive troubleshooting, consult the instruction manual for your specific Senco framing nailer.
